A. rather serious stabbing case took place near the Greenham Burton estate, §outhbridge, on Monday nightV A yoqng man named Frederick Attwood mot T. Carr, and mistaking him for another matj against whqra he had bad feeling, stabbed him, inflicting two serious wounds in the right arm. On discorering bis mistake Attwbod expressed great contrition, He was brought before R. B. Willis, R.M., on Wednesday, and remanded till Fib. 22nd.
